GoSun Sport Solar Oven

Overview

The GoSun Sport Solar Oven is a game-changer in portable cooking. It uses special vacuum tubes to capture and keep heat, letting you cook food with just sunlight. This innovative approach makes it a top choice for cooking off the grid.

Pros

  • It doesn’t need fuel or electricity to work.
  • Its design is perfect for taking on the go, whether camping or for backyard use.
  • The vacuum insulation keeps it cool to the touch outside.

Cons

It only works well when it’s sunny. Cooking might take longer than with gas or electric ovens. It’s not good for cloudy days or at night.

Features

This oven has a strong, heat-insulating glass tube. It can get up to 550°F, making sure your food is cooked right. It’s a clean, smoke-free option for those who love the outdoors.

Factors to Consider When Choosing Solar Tech

Looking for solar-powered gear can be tough without knowing the key performance metrics. When you’re shopping for energy-saving devices, ignore the marketing buzz. Instead, focus on the technical specs that show how well they work in real life.

Understanding Conversion Efficiency

Conversion efficiency shows how much sunlight a solar panel turns into electricity. A higher efficiency means more power in a smaller space. This is crucial for portable gear.

Today’s consumer panels usually have an efficiency between 15% and 23%. Picking a higher efficiency model means your gear charges quicker. This is true even on cloudy days or when the sun is scarce.

Durability and Weather Resistance

Outdoor solar gadgets need to handle tough weather. Look for an Ingress Protection (IP) rating to see how well they resist dust and water.

Good gear has a tough outer shell and strong ports to keep out moisture. Buying durable gear means your sustainable investment will work well on camping trips or in emergencies.

Battery Capacity and Storage

The battery’s capacity shows how much energy it can store for later use. It’s measured in milliamp-hours (mAh) or watt-hours (Wh). Choosing the right size is key for managing power effectively.

If you need to charge many devices, go for energy-saving devices with big batteries. Make sure the battery size matches your devices’ power needs. This way, you won’t run out of power when you need it most.
